

Gardenstown is a compact, colorful fishing village on the Moray Firth—charming harbor, rows of painted cottages on steep streets, rocky foreshore and sea stacks. Photograph pastel houses reflected in wet cobbles, fishing boats and nets, dramatic Atlantic light at sunrise/sunset, and stormy waves in winter. Narrow roads and limited parking near the harbour; best visits at sunrise or late golden hour for soft side-light and long shadows. Quiet village etiquette—be respectful of residents. No entry
